TSN’s Bob McKenzie talking to local TSN radio announcer TSN Dustin Nielson, who tweeted last night that Edmonton Oilers are in talks with free agent d-man Kris Russell. Said McKenzie: “I think he probably would be a decent fit for the Oilers, especially on a short term deal. That is obviously the key. It’s not an absolute given, but I won’t be surprised when Kris Russell signs a contract that he signs a one-year deal. I’m just guessing here, and it is that, a guess, I got to figure it’s probably going to be worth somewhere between $4 and 5 million a year.
